Закрыто

[Повтор] [Udemy] Парсеры, роботы, автоматизация, Selenium, PhantomJS на PHP

Тема в разделе "Курсы по программированию", создана пользователем htrmaster, 19 ноя 2018.

Цена: 660р-87%
Взнос: 80р
100%

Основной список: 42 участников

Резервный список: 1 участников

Статус обсуждения:
Комментирование ограничено.
  1. 19 ноя 2018
    #1
    htrmaster
    htrmaster ДолжникДолжник

    Складчина: [Повтор] [Udemy] Парсеры, роботы, автоматизация, Selenium, PhantomJS на PHP

    Станьте профессиональным разработчиком парсеров, роботов. Научитесь работать с Selenium, PhantomJS и cURL с PHP
    2018-11-19_12-46-22.png
    Чему вы научитесь
    Вы сможете создавать парсеры и роботы
    Вы сможете парсить любые сайты
    Вы сможете писать автоматизированные тесты веб-приложений
    Вы сможете создавать копии сайтов

    Материалы курса: 22 лекции, общее время: 03:12:52

    –Введение 04:59
    Что будет рассмотрено в курсе 04:59

    –Простой парсинг 53:14
    Подключаем библиотеку для парсинга 05:00
    Тест. Получаем исходный код страницы 02:30
    Получаем ссылки на каждую из статей со страницы каталога 04:28
    Работа с паджинацией (когда каталог, контент разбит на страницы). Рекурсия 04:44
    Парсинг каждой отдельной статьи 04:41
    Создаем таблицу articles для хранения данных парсинга 04:19
    Добавляем ссылки на каждую статью в таблицу БД 04:48
    Парсим и сохраняем каждую статью в БД 03:11
    Переносим парсер вчистовик. CLI 04:51
    Сохранение статей в БД. Парсер готов 04:54
    Как параллельно запустить много потоков парсера? Часть 1 04:57
    Как параллельно запустить много потоков парсера? Часть 2 04:51

    –PhantomJS и PHP. Парсим сайты. Создаем живую копию сайта Zappos.com 01:58:07
    Знакомимся с PhantomJS. Командная строка. Скриншоты сайтов. Исходный код сайта 16:20
    Работа PhantomJS и PHP. Приложение-генератор скриншотов сайтов. Меняем UserAgent 34:29
    Парсим Zappos.com. Часть 1: пишем JS код для получения ссылок категорий товаров 11:43
    Парсим Zappos.com. Часть 2: получаем JSON со ссылками. Внедрение кода с evaluate 07:04
    Парсим Zappos.com. Часть 3: пишем JSON в файл из PhantomJS. Читаем его из PHP 08:32
    Парсим Zappos.com. Часть 4: Рекурсия в PhantomJS - берем страницы из педжинации 23:27
    Парсим Zappos.com. Часть 5: Получаем ссылки на все товары со страницы каталога 08:43
    Парсим Zappos.com. Часть 6: пишем ссылки на все товары категории в JSON файл 07:49

    –Бонус. Безлимитный Google Translate без ключа API. Парсинг Google Translate 16:32
    Парсим Google Translate с PhantomJS. Передача аргументов из командной строки 16:32
    Добавить размер окна через viewportSize и установить userAgent, как будто Chrome 1 вопрос
    Перевод больших текстов с переносами строк 1 вопрос

    папка на яндекс.диск


    Предыдущая складчина (описание отличается, непонятно насколько актуально)

    Продажник
     
    Последнее редактирование: 19 ноя 2018
    2 пользователям это понравилось.
  2. Последние события

    1. skladchik.com
      Складчина закрыта.
      7 окт 2025
    2. Krikona
      Krikona оставил отзыв "Средне".
      8 окт 2019
    3. Tans
      Tans оставил отзыв "Средне".
      24 ноя 2018
    4. skladchik.com
      Складчина доступна.
      22 ноя 2018

    Последние важные события

    1. skladchik.com
      Складчина закрыта.
      7 окт 2025
    2. skladchik.com
      Складчина доступна.
      22 ноя 2018
    3. skladchik.com
      Взнос в складчине составляет 40р.
      22 ноя 2018
    4. skladchik.com
      Складчина активна.
      22 ноя 2018
  3. Отзывы участников

    3/5,
    • 3/5,
      Работой организатора доволен
      Нет существенной части материала, который должен был быть. Автор начал парсить сайт интернет-магазина и остановился ровно после того, как получил всего-лишь ссылки на страницы товаров, дальше должен был показать большой фронт работы, но ничего не показал, конец. Для меня было очень неожиданно найти конец в самом начале пути. Курс мог бы претендовать на хорошую оценку, если бы это был полный курс, а тут только отрывок курса :-/
      8 окт 2019
      2 пользователям это понравилось.
    • 3/5,
      Работой организатора доволен
      И половины того что заявлено в баннере нету, возможно это какая то первая часть. Про селениум, curl (прокси+куки), ничего не сказано, кроме как в водном курсе (сказано только что это будет в курсе). Также ничего нет про тему с прокси-сервисом магазина (копии сайтов). Нет автоматизации браузера, нет ничего про тесты.
      Насчет любых сайтов он конечно погорячился, варианты показаны довольно простые, для сложных сайтов все может быть сильно сложнее.
      У меня большой опыт в данной теме, было скучно (хотя смотрел x2). Новичкам возможно будет интересно, база про парсинг есть. Инструменты хоть и устарели и имеют уже лучшие аналоги, но в целом надо признать еще актуальны. Поэтому тройку наверное заслужил.
      24 ноя 2018
      9 пользователям это понравилось.
  4. Обсуждение
  5. 20 ноя 2018
    #2
    Tans
    Tans ЧКЧлен клуба
    зачем они только с фантомом связались, для новичков это погибель, там же не видно что происходит в этом браузере. и есть же нормальный пупетир.
    селениум тоже тот еще диназаврик - в нем есть смысл разве что в тестах, тк поддерживает несколько браузеров.
    имхо курс походу отстал на пару тройку лет по технологиям, но посмотрим.
     
Статус обсуждения:
Комментирование ограничено.